| Graphic card's problem ? I just changed my Vid card .. and game crash always happen now when I was playing Unreal , NSFU2 .. ( but not Far Cry ) , it says the VPU stop responding and need recovery .. blah blah blah ... How to solve this ? Setup : GeCube Radeon 9550 XT ( without oc ) Catalyst 4.11 Win XP SP2 Every games run on it default settings =/ Thanks |
30th November 2004, 13:49 | #2 |
Posts: n/a
| what psu? lots of other stuff plugged in to your pc? (usb devices that get their juice form the usb plug, hdds, cd/dvd roms, fans, ccfls, ...) what card did you have before? try with the bare necessities: only mobo, ram, vidcard, cpu, psu, boot hdd (and if you have your games on a seperate hdd, that one too, if you need the cd to play the game, that one too ) if it still doesn't work, do a clean install with again only the bare necessities. windows, drivers, the games that crash. if you don't have a spare hdd to do the clean install on, make a seperate partition (partition magic) |
